Transaction 28d1334fe43f10ff76fcdbed4e867381cca7302673990e8dad56e95a2fccb86a

2 Input
2 Outputs
  • 28d1334fe43f10ff76fcdbed4e867381cca7302673990e8dad56e95a2fccb86a:0
  • value  20000000
    address  15B96YecaUqqgEjaeUM2GjStqhKNVx7Z1X
  • 28d1334fe43f10ff76fcdbed4e867381cca7302673990e8dad56e95a2fccb86a:1
  • value  569451
    address  32q7KZC4sNJWhQ5WhnXFrPrSPwg4B2Qyk1